Two Shot Moulding, also known as two-component moulding or over moulding, involves the use of specialized injection moulding machines to produce parts made of two different materials in a single operation. This process allows for the integration of different colors, materials, and properties within a single component, resulting in a finished product that is more durable, aesthetically pleasing, and functional. The technology has gained widespread popularity in various industries, including automotive, consumer goods, electronics, and medical devices, among others.

The key advantage of Two Shot Moulding lies in its ability to create complex parts with multiple materials, colors, and textures in a single operation. This eliminates the need for secondary assembly or bonding processes, reducing production time, material waste, and overall costs. Furthermore, the technology allows for the seamless integration of dissimilar materials, such as hard and soft plastics, rubber and plastic, or even metal and plastic, opening up new possibilities for product innovation and differentiation.
